Definition of nymph :
1. A goddess of the mountains, forests, meadows, or waters.
2. A lovely young girl; a maiden; a damsel.
3. Any one of a subfamily ( Najades) of butterflies including the purples, the fritillaries, the peacock butterfly, etc.; - called also naiad.
4. of Nympha
5. The pupa of an insect; a chrysalis.
